WebApr 8, 2024 · Childcare Allowance – If your dependent child is under 15 on the first day of the academic year, or they are under 17 and are registered with special educational needs, you could receive funding for up to 85% of your childcare costs, capped at £128.78 per week for one child or £191.45 per week for two or more children.

WebParental Support (formerly Child Dependants Allowance) Eligible students attending a full time pre-registration healthcare course will be able to claim a set amount of £2,000 per academic year. This is available to students who have parental responsibility for a child who is either: under the age of 15 years WebIf you applied for one child in registered childcare and it cost £200 per week for 40 weeks. The amount owed to you is 85% of £200, which is £170. This is over the maximum set amount, so we’ll calculate your entitlement at £128.78 per week. £128.78 multiplied by …
